GOV IKPEAZU SWEARS IN 27 COMMISSIONERS
REPORTER: LAWRENCE NWOKEDI
Governor Okezie Ikpeazu of Abia State has sworn in twenty-seven new commissioners with a charge to ensure that they contribute their own quota towards the development of the state.
At the event in Umuahia, Governor Ikpeazu, urged the commissioners to see their posts as a call to the service of the state and the people.
He assured the commissioners that he would provide them with the enabling environment to perform their duties optimally.
The Governor warned that he would not hesitate to drop any of them found wanting in his duty.
One of the newly sworn-in commissioners is Mr. Karibe Ojigwe former Senior National team player who was assigned to the Ministry of Sports,
